Odesa Police Investigate Desecration of Fallen Soldier Memorial in Serhiivka

(Photo: National Police in Odesa region)

Law enforcement officers in Odesa region are investigating an act of desecration of the memory of a fallen Ukrainian soldier.

According to the press service of the regional police, the incident occurred on the Alley of Glory in the village of Serhiivka, Bilhorod-Dnistrovskyi district.

"Officers of the Bilhorod-Dnistrovskyi District Police Department were working at the scene. Investigators registered the incident in the Unified Register of Pre-trial Investigations under Part 1 of Article 296 (hooliganism) of the Criminal Code of Ukraine," the statement said.

Photo: Odesa police press service

Investigative and operational actions are currently underway to identify those involved in the crime.

On December 6, on the Day of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, new stands dedicated to the memory of 144 defenders who died in the war were opened in Odesa.

Earlier, Odesa had planned to install video surveillance cameras on the Alley of Heroes in Shevchenko Park. The city was ready to allocate UAH 585,500 for their purchase and installation. However, the auction was canceled. The Heroes' Alley in Shevchenko Park was officially opened on the Day of Remembrance of the Defenders of Ukraine, August 29.

Meanwhile, the Housing and Communal Services Department of the Izmail City Council has begun searching for a contractor to overhaul part of Victory Square and create an Alley of Glory to honor the memory of the fallen defenders of Izmail. The customer estimated the cost of the work at UAH 12 million 537 thousand. The funding will be divided into two stages: UAH 6.37 million of the total amount will be allocated from the city treasury this year, and the rest - in 2026.

On December 5, on Volunteer Day and the eve of the Day of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, a new part of the memorial "Wall of Memory" was unveiled in Odesa near the Cathedral of the Nativity of the Orthodox Church of Ukraine on Pastera Street.
